Anti-ICE protests in Los Angeles turned violent as tensions flared between demonstrators and immigration authorities. Democratic lawmaker Norma Torres faced criticism for telling ICE agents to leave California, sparking backlash on social media. President Trump sent National Guard soldiers to Los Angeles to maintain peace during the unrest.
